Arem edit

Etymology edit

From Proto-Vietic *pʰruːʔ, from Proto-Mon-Khmer *t₁praw; cognate with Vietnamese sáu.

Pronunciation edit

Numeral edit

parau

  1. six

Indonesian edit

Etymology edit

From Malay parau, from Proto-Austronesian *paʀaw (hoarse).

Pronunciation edit

  • IPA(key): [ˈparau̯]
  • Hyphenation: pa‧rau

Adjective edit

parau

  1. hoarse.
    Synonyms: garau, serak

Malay edit

Etymology edit

From Proto-Austronesian *paʀaw (hoarse).

Pronunciation edit

Adjective edit

parau (Jawi spelling ڤاراو)

  1. hoarse (of a voice)
    Synonyms: serak, garau, garuk
    Suara parauHoarse voice
